建立Redis集群直连模式简介(redis集群直连模式)
Redis 是一款开源的高性能键值存储,相较于传统关系型数据库,它的性能更优秀,也有更好的扩展性,因此被众多开发者及公司所采纳。Redis 集群是 Redis 的一种扩展模式,它允许数据存储到多个 Redis 节点,以提高存储容量及客户端负载。
Redis 集群有直连模式和代理模式两种部署方式,其中直连模式是最简单的部署模式,它没有中间代理层,每个客户端都直接与 Redis 集群的所有节点相连接。
下面我们介绍怎么通过直连模式建立 Redis 集群:
1. 下载 Redis 并安装,这里我们以单机部署为例。
2. 配置 Redis 集群节点,设置不同的绑定端口和 cluster-announce-ip 和 cluster-announce-port、cluster-config-file 等参数。
3. 初始化集群,使用 redis-trib.rb 将节点加入到 Redis 集群中。
4. 监控 Redis 集群,已确保其正常运行。
下面给出一个例子,我们通过直连模式建立了一个 4 个节点的 Redis 集群:
# 下载Redis
$ wget http://download.redis.io/releases/redis-5.0.7.tar.gz
$ tar xzf redis-5.0.7.tar.gz
$ cd redis-5.0.7
# 启动4个节点:
$ src/redis-server port 6379 cluster-announce-ip 192.168.1.100 cluster-announce-port 6379 cluster-config-file nodes.conf
$ src/redis-server port 6380 cluster-announce-ip 192.168.1.100 cluster-announce-port 6380 cluster-config-file nodes.conf
$ src/redis-server port 6381 cluster-announce-ip 192.168.1.100 cluster-announce-port 6381 cluster-config-file nodes.conf
$ src/redis-server port 6382 cluster-announce-ip 192.168.1.100 cluster-announce-port 6382 cluster-config-file nodes.conf
# 初始化集群:
$ src/redis-trib.rb create replicas 1 192.168.1.100:6379 192.168.1.100:6380 192.168.1.100:6381 192.168.1.100:6382
# 监控Redis集群:
$ src/redis-cli cluster check 192.168.1.100:6379
# 查看Redis集群节点:
$ src/redis-cli cluster nodes
以上是利用直连模式建立一个 4 个节点的 Redis 集群的步骤,它更加简单,一步就可以将多台机器联合成一个集群,每一步的操作都可不服务的文档中找到相应的说明,这样建立 Redis 集群的过程将更加成功。
我想要获取技术服务或软件
服务范围:MySQL、ORACLE、SQLSERVER、MongoDB、PostgreSQL 、程序问题
服务方式:远程服务、电话支持、现场服务,沟通指定方式服务
技术标签:数据恢复、安装配置、数据迁移、集群容灾、异常处理、其它问题
本站部分文章参考或来源于网络,如有侵权请联系站长。
数据库远程运维 建立Redis集群直连模式简介(redis集群直连模式)
相关文章
- 最大化Redis键值的提升技巧(redis键值大小)
- Redis硬盘持久化实践(redis使用硬盘)
- 管理Redis集群:实现高效并发管理(redis集群并发)
- Redis集群:实现高性能的多服务器数据管理(redis多服务器集群)
- 搭建Redis服务器集群,极大提升性能(redis服务器集群)
- 利用Redis实现多线程操作的优化(redis多线程操作)
- 提升网站的性能如何利用Redis提高网站性能(怎么利用redis)
- 零门槛,享受开源Redis(开源软件redis)
- 部署Redis集群,赋能虚拟机存储服务(虚拟机 redis集群)
- 提升Redis持久性有效数据保障方案(提高redis持久化)
- 大规模锁定Redis,实现批量操作(批量操作redis加锁)
- Solr与Redis的比较分析(solr redis对比)
- 测试Redis,简单又高效(如何对redis进行测试)
- 为提高性能,多服务器集群搭建Redis(多服务器 redis)
- 提升Redis性能连接池配置的重要性(redis需要配置连接池)
- 重大失误Redis集群重启失败(redis 集群重启失败)
- 让你抓狂的Redis集群配置(redis集群配置的难点)
- Redis集群快速搭建从YML配置开始(redis集群配置yml)
- Redis集群清理为首先步(redis集群清理key)
- Redis集群实现技术探究(redis 集群实现方式)
- 分布与存储Redis集群数据分布与存储原理(redis集群原理 数据)
- Redis集群优化内存使用方式实现增长(redis集群内存增长)
- 使用Redis集群实现高可用(redis集群之实例)
- Redis中的递增功能简洁实用的特性(redis递增是什么意思)
- Redis中的飞驰耗时命令(redis耗时的命令)
- 用Redis解决乱码查询问题(redis查出数据乱码)